Definition und Bedeutung von „distract“ im Englischen

to distract
01

ablenken, die Aufmerksamkeit ablenken

to cause someone to lose their focus or attention from something they were doing or thinking about
Transitive: to distract sb
to distract definition and meaning
example
Beispiele
The loud music from the party next door distracted them from their peaceful evening at home.
Die laute Musik von der Party nebenan lenkte sie von ihrem friedlichen Abend zu Hause ab.
02

ablenken, verwirren

to make someone feel confused or torn by mixing up their emotions or intentions
Transitive: to distract sb
example
Beispiele
The constant pressure of the situation distracted her.
Der ständige Druck der Situation zerstreute sie.
